  • Patent number: 9090401
    Abstract: A chain link for a curved conveyor chain, the chain link comprising a base body and a bolt, the base body having an articulation section and a fork section and a carrier means for carrying material that is to be conveyed, the bolt being elongated and designed in a circular cylindrical manner in at least one central section. In the articulation section, a bolt opening is provided through which the bolt can pass and can rotate relative to at least two axes. The fork section has an articulation recess for receiving the articulation section of an adjoining identical chain link, the fork section having two opposite bolt recesses which can receive the opposite ends of the bolt of the adjoining chain link. The articulation and fork sections of two adjoining, identical chain links are maintained at a distance by two slide sections.

  • Patent number: 8136652
    Abstract: A processing station for a processing line, having a module platform (12) and a plurality of withdrawable modules (14) that can be introduced into it has a transporting device (40, 42) for transporting workpieces (59) to be processed at the processing station (10). According to the invention, the transporting device (40, 42) includes a plurality of part-transporting devices (43), and one part-transporting device (43) is associated with each withdrawable module (14) and is solidly connected to the withdrawable module (14). Moreover, at least some of the part-transporting devices 43 include a first transportation path (40), which is embodied for transporting a workpiece (56) essentially over the width of the withdrawable module (14) in a first transporting direction (T1).

  • Publication number: 20090294249
    Abstract: A device is described for transporting workpiece holders between multiple processing stations, a traction mechanism conveyor line being provided having at least one conveyor unit and at least one transfer unit for transferring the workpiece holders between the traction mechanism conveyor line and a processing station. The workpiece holders lie loosely on the traction mechanism conveyor line and project laterally beyond the traction mechanism conveyor line, and the transfer unit is situated at least partially below the conveyor plane and movable perpendicular thereto in such a way that the workpiece holders are graspable from below by the transfer unit at their area projecting beyond the traction mechanism conveyor line.

  • Patent number: 6779652
    Abstract: A chain link (10) of a curved conveyor chain has been proposed, which has a carrying device (12) for transport material. A head part (24) disposed under the carrying device (12) has a lateral bore (40) for a pin (48) of a first adjacent chain link (10). The head part (24) is adjoined by a fork-shaped section (26) with two legs (44), which encompass the head part (24) of a second adjacent chain link (10). The legs (44) and contain lateral bores (46). A pin (48) is also provided, which is contained in the lateral bores (46) of the legs (44) and in the head part (24) of the second adjacent chain link (10). Projections (52) protrude from the legs (44) and are designed to be guided in a guide profile and driven by means of a driving wheel. The object of the invention is to produce a chain link (10), which permits a favorable introduction of force.
